Hi !

There are 2 questions in the quiz regarding the units of AFR (imperial and metrics), as far as i understood AFR is just a ratio of how many grams of air to burn complete qty of fuel (whatever it is) therefore i wasn't expecting any units from it.

I would have understood the question if we were dealing with BSFC where we have a clear unit wether in imperial or metrics and the correct answer to gives looks like BSFC units.

Is there something wrong there of i'm mistaken about AFR ?

Thanks

I don't know the specific question, but as AFR stands for Air Fuel Ratio, I would expect you to be correct in your reasoning - it would be xxx:1. Whatever unit of weight or mass - pounds, grammes, stones, tonnes, or whatever - you use, they would cancel out.

It may be a mistake with thewrong answer linked to the question - is there another question with a puzzling answer?

Yup, you're right, those options are for BSFC and NOT AFR - "bit" sloppy making the same mistake twice.

One might argue that if using grammes for the mass, the power should have been in Watts, rather than kilowatts, but that might be a bit picky.
